Default HP C4599 Photosmart Printer

An old co-worker of mine called me up and said he was having issues with his new printer.
So, I went over to his place and attempted to diagnose the issue. He had the geek squad and everyone in the book come over and attempted to get it to work.

It's brand new and everything appeared to be installed properly. For some odd reason, HP requires that after every cartridge replacement, It has to be aligned. I've attemted printing the page out and then throwing it on the scanner and then it fails to align.

I've went onto websites and printed everything fine except the black is not a true black. It's almost like it has no ink and uses the color cartridge to make a black color. But when I go into the HP properties it shows both cartridges are full.

Now, I think this is the funniest thing I've ever seen. I've owned Epson printers for years and have never had to go through an alignment process.

I think the lower quality is due to the fact it won't align the cartridges...

Default Re: HP C4599 Photosmart Printer

It sounds like to me a actual hardware failure with the print head or jets (Nozzles), I'm not a expert on this or anything but here is a link that you could read up on to try and clean it.

Smart Computing Article - How To Clean A Dirty Print Head

The other thing I would do because I know hp printer drivers can sometimes be very finicky is make sure you have the latest driver from the hp website if you already have the latest driver then try un-installing the driver and doing a clean install of the driver from the disc the printer came with. (I know this last bit sounds odd but sometimes older drivers just work better or have better functions for different tasks over others like alignment or head cleaning etc...).
